HDV(m2t) Source
Common Options
See Common Source Options.
HDV(m2t)-specific options
Name
Module Name
Set this name to affect the target name handling. This setting can be used as a source
file base name (use %s on the target side).
Notes
No notes.
Basic Settings
Length
Displays the length of the source in hours:nimutes:seconds;frames for drop-frame
timecode and hours:nimutes:seconds;frames for non-drop-frame timecode.
Source File
Displays the name of the source file.
Use timestamp
Enable this option to use timestamp to specify the In/Out positions.
Transport Stream
Stream Type
Displays the type of the stream.
Program Number
A transport stream can have multiple programs. Specify the program ID to decode
here.
Program/System
Stream Type
Displays the stream type of the multiplex source.
Flags
Displays the list of flags declared in the stream.
Video Stream
Specifies the video stream ID to decode.
